About this house rental

One of the most unique properties in the region, StoneHouse was originally the farmstead of Sam Kimble, one of the early settlers to the Manhattan area. Respectfully restored, this 1860’s-era limestone estate features unsurpassed elegance in its amenities, while celebrating the heritage of its past by leaving many of the original elements exposed, including field-milled rafters, hand-hewn timbers, ancient limestone walls, and wide-plank wood floors with their original square-head nails. With a farmhouse-inspired kitchen, dynamic great room, luxury bathrooms with deep-soaker tubs, and lush courtyard with saltwater hot tub, this is a dream destination full of frontier charm. Perfect for friend or family getaways, business retreats, or small events, StoneHouse is highly versatile, intentionally intimate, unusually private, and thoroughly welcoming.

10 / 10Outstanding·Apr 2025
Gorgeous, fully renovated 19th century farm house. Great rural setting on outskirts of Manhattan with nature and trails on site. If everyone in your group can handle the steep, narrow stairs inside the home and outside on the property, this listing is a 5 star gem! Seriously though, this property is not for anyone with mobility issues. One of our favorite finds in the past 10 years! Owners are awesome and have great communication.
